Description |
Mac OS X contains a flaw that may allow a malicious user to change network settings. The issue is triggered when a local user modifies the configd file. It is possible that the flaw may allow arbitrary changes in network settings resulting in a loss of integrity.

Solution |
Currently, there are no known workarounds or upgrades to correct this issue. However, Apple has released a patch to address this vulnerability.
